Use mailto javascript. js, and server-side methods: email API and Node.
Use mailto javascript. . I found out, you can simply insert an iframe with the mailto link into the dom. There are a two common approaches to use mailto in JavaScript: Dynamically create an anchor tag with href set to a mailto link; Set window. var email = "random@random. After entering an email at aemail. I'm new to javascript and the following code isn't working: <script>. What is "mailto"? "mailto" is a function in JavaScript that allows you to create a link that, when clicked, opens the user's default email client with a new email Oct 5, 2010 · Actually, there is a possibillity to avoid the empty page. Third-party hosted options exist if you don't want to do any server-side programming yourself. Using Mailto in JavaScript. The only two limitations on the body are as follows: Benefits of Sending Email Using Javascript. It saves time, since the process is automated and users do not need to open their default email client. Although Unicode characters are still likely to fail but then the whole thing is very likely to fail anyway. value; window. We can use JavaScript to send our email messages. Is there any possible method to check if the email is configured (i. var yourMessage = document. It's the Framework7 library. var mail="mailto:chrisgreg23@googlemail. Unlike traditional email links, which open the user’s default email client, mailto enables you to customize the email’s subject, body, recipient, and other parameters. href property to redirect the user to mailto:email@example. href = "mailto: [email protected] "; mail. href property; Anchor tags with the href attribute Apr 16, 2012 · With JavaScript you can create a link 'on the fly' using something like: var mail = document. But there are other parameters also you can send it along with that, those are: 1. Anyone can help me? Nov 10, 2010 · This way, any spam crawlers that do not execute Javascript won't get your address. Advantages of using mailto links. ) with attachment Mar 8, 2016 · I'm trying to add a mailto link in a pdf document that opens a new email with the said document as an attachment. Any solution involving submitting a form to a web server and sending email using server-side programming won't. I want to have something along the lines like this, so it opens a new email on outlook. A good reason to use a mailto link is if you are sending emails to a group of people that Nov 20, 2022 · How do I use the "mailto" function in JavaScript for a table containing product details function SendEmail() { var email = document. We can send a mail using mailto: in HTML and JavaScript. Also, the convention for encoding information into URLs and URIs is defined in RFC 1738 and then RFC 3986. createElement("a"); mail. Apr 24, 2015 · Javascriptでリアルタイムに結果を表示する計算フォーム; JavaScriptでhtmlの内容を変更; JavaScript:リサイズ時にレイヤーを画面サイズにフィットさせる; JavaScript:レイヤーを画面サイズにフィットさせる; Javascriptでファイルアップロード時に選択ファイル名を Jan 10, 2013 · how to send mail automatically using mailto with attachment from outlook using JavaScript and html 0 Open default email client (outlook, thunderbird, gmail, etc. com?subject="+subject+"&body Nov 8, 2023 · In this comprehensive guide, we‘ll explore step-by-step how to use mailto in JavaScript. random" Jun 22, 2023 · One way to do this is by using the "mailto" function in JavaScript. Using Javascript to send emails has many benefits. To create a Mailto link, you need to use the HTML <a> tag with its href attribute, and insert a "mailto:" parameter after it, like the following: Jan 24, 2011 · The mailto: URL scheme is defined in RFC 2368. getElemenById("list"). Nov 16, 2021 · One of the downsides to using a mailto link is that it does often come across as spam by users. So just keep that in mind when you're using it. The issue is that, the functionality works fine but there is a special character  before the currency symbol and i am clueless what might be the reason. I have a button on my appscreen that is supposed to bring up the device's mail client. getElementById("message"). click(); No exemplo de código, uma tag âncora com o nome email foi criada e adicionamos a funcionalidade mailto a ela usando o atributo href . I want to emphasize or highlight the user1 and pass1. emailjs. href = "mailto:" + $('#email'). js. I've tried styling in html and css, and also in JavaScript using . com, you will get a short URL, which can be used to replace your 'mailto' link. com: @email is a free e-mail hiding service that hides emails using short URLs redirecting senders to the mailto-url after clicking the link. It also boosts user experience by streamlined communication with customers and other users. However, we cannot use just JavaScript. It allows you to automate notifications, send user−generated content, or facilitate communication with your users. This works on current Firefox/Chrome and IE (also IE will display a short confirm dialog). getElementById("selectList"). Unfortunately, a lot of spammers will use this option to send emails to users. locat Apr 4, 2024 · To use mailto in JavaScript: Add a load event listener to the window object. An emoji can be added either before or after the link using pseudo selectors to make the link a little more obvious for the user to inform what they’re about to click on, or as a bit of decoration. click(function(){ window. cc 2. I'm currently making an app for mobile devices that uses HTML and Javascript. bold() but it's not working. In this article, we will explore how to use "mailto" in React and JavaScript to create buttons that send emails. bcc 3 RFC 2368 says that mailto body content must be URL-encoded, using the %-escaped form for characters that would normally be encoded in a URL. Sending E-mails with JavaScript: EmailJS. var email = document . Whether you‘re a beginner or an experienced JavaScript developer, you‘ll learn how to implement mailto links using: The window. Those characters includes spaces and (as called out explicitly in section 5 of 2368) CR and LF. io Jun 20, 2020 · How to send email using JavaScript and HTML using - mailto, by invoking a mail client and pre-formatted email contents. The reason for this is, yet again, our favorite canned meat Apr 18, 2024 · Overall, mailto is a great way to streamline email communication from your web pages. If you're afraid of spam crawlers that do use Javascript, you can only write the email address on mousemove and/or after 5 seconds. – Oct 29, 2008 · The specification for 'mailto' body says: The body of a message is simply lines of US-ASCII characters. Use a server-side solution. createElement( 'a' ); email. whether any default email service to send email - such as Outlook - is Oct 12, 2023 · Use o código abaixo e adicione a funcionalidade mailto a qualquer elemento usando JavaScript. open("mailto:[email protected]"); } Jun 20, 2020 · How to send email using JavaScript and HTML using - mailto, by invoking a mail client and pre-formatted email contents. When the event runs, use the window. com. href directly to a mailto link I am using a mailto: filled in JavaScript to send information throughout my web application, but everytime a user presses the Send button, it opens a new tab in the browser before opening the mailing application (Outlook, Gmail, etc). There is not a straight answer to your question as we can not send email only using javascript, but there are ways to use javascript to send emails for us: 1) using an api to and call the api via javascript to send the email for us, for example https://www. Jul 13, 2024 · Learn how to send email in JavaScript using client-side methods: mailto, EmailJS, and SMTP. com' ; email. click(); This is redirected by the browser to some mail client installed on the machine without losing the content of the current window and you would not need any API like 'jQuery'. So in general, the mailto command isn’t widely used any longer. What is the best way out? I've tried calling a javascript function using-onClick that looks like this - function foo(){ window. When the user clicks on a mailto link, the default email client opens on the user’s computer and suggests sending an email to the address included in the mailto link. We have a bit of an issue with people giving incorrect emails on the form and I’m gonna switch to mailto to get rid of that. We can use different methods like using Malito protocol, sending Emails with a Server−Side Language, and HTML 使用Javascript创建mailto链接 在本文中,我们将介绍如何使用JavaScript在HTML中创建mailto链接。mailto链接是一种特殊的超链接,可以直接打开用户的默认电子邮件应用程序,并在邮件中自动填写收件人、主题和正文。 阅读更多:HTML 教程 什么是mailto链接? Apr 25, 2018 · Is it possible to insert a BOLD/bigger characters when using mailto in javaScript? Username: user1 Password: pass1. location. Dec 17, 2023 · Another disadvantage is that spammers look for the mailto/email address combination. Feb 29, 2016 · window. Apr 4, 2024 · To use mailto in JavaScript: Add a load event listener to the window object. Sep 1, 2023 · JavaScript mailto is a technique that allows developers to create interactive and dynamic email links on web pages. function sendMail() {. Apr 4, 2024 · To use mailto in JavaScript: Add a load event listener to the window object. Mar 30, 2013 · In this tutorial we are going to see how to write a javascript mailto function so that both the subject and body will be Pre-filled? Many of us might have used mailto function just like below (passing only the mail id): mailto: someone@example. I Feb 23, 2010 · seemed to suggest, on mobile especially, conversion is better using mailto. I'm creating a custom button on my webpage which actually is a <div>, I want to trigger a mailto when the button is clicked. For accesibility reasons, and for humans with Javascript disabled, you may want to include a scrambled form of the address in plain You can use external services like aemail. e. href doesn't work with it; we need to use a button who will run a function. Jul 10, 2014 · I am using a simple mailto option in my html so that whenever the user clicks on the mailto, it creates a pre defined email with subject and body. val(); }); mailto: URLs are very unreliable and (when they work) always interact with the mail client on the user's machine. com says that you can use such a code below to call their api after some setting: Sep 16, 2015 · We can't use a submit input, because window. look at the mailto sintax here or post some more info so that we can help you; This could be done like this : $('input[type=submit]'). And it's all, very simple :) Share When a user clicks on the Mailto link, the default email client on the visitor's computer opens and suggests sending a message to the email address mentioned in the Mailto link. Sep 16, 2013 · I need to know if its possible to pass variables to the mailto: method. var subject = document. Click here. Jul 23, 2024 · What is a Mailto Link in HTML? Mailto links are used to redirect the user to an email address instead of a link. Let‘s look at how we can leverage it in JavaScript. href = 'mailto:[email protected]'; this will open the predefined mail client and you can also prefill some field. The user would just need to type the email in and send it Nov 7, 2008 · Use encodeURIComponent in preference to escape which follows arbitrary rules different from URL-encoding. js, and server-side methods: email API and Node. These prescribe how to include the body and subject headers into a URL (URI): Mar 22, 2019 · There shouldn’t be any GDPR concerns using mailto links in content. mailto links with parameters are super-unreliable and shouldn't really be used. Apr 27, 2022 · Learn how to send emails with JavaScript for both front-end and back-end development. value. See full list on mailtrap. com mailto using javascript (7 answers) Closed 10 years ago. Also something I particularly like is when you get a response from mailto you know the email address is correct. Jul 18, 2023 · How to send an email from JavaScript - Sending emails from javascript is a common feature in most web applications. href = 'mailto:abc@mail. hpuhk muim mgho djsl qsojslt hpkb dshdg ooxizu dsza qbaql